Subj : Indonesian Inspired Tempeh Stew To : All From : Ben Collver Date : Thu Dec 11 2025 05:59 am M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06 Title: Indonesian Inspired Tempeh Stew Categories: Indonesian, Stews Yield: 4 Servings 2 tb Olive oil 8 oz Tempeh; steamed & cubed 3 Shallots; chopped 3 cl Garlic; minced 1 sm Fresh hot chile; - seeded & minced 1 ts Fresh ginger; grated 1 lg Sweet potato; peeled & diced 1 c Water 14 1/2 oz Can crushed tomatoes 1 tb Low-sodium tamari 1 c Unsweetened coconut milk Salt Black pepper; freshly ground 2 tb Fresh cilantro; minced 1 ts Lime zest; minced Heat 1 tb ol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the tempeh and brown on all sides, about 5 minutes. Set aside. Heat the remaining 1 tb olive o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add the shallots, garlic, chile, and ginger. Cook, stirring, until softened, about 5 minutes. Add the sweet potato, water, tomatoes, and tamari. Cover and cook,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ables are tender, about 20 minutes. Uncover and reduce the heat to low. Add the coconut milk, salt & pepper to taste, and tempeh. Simmer, stirring occasionally, until thickened, about 10 minutes. Just before serving, stir in the cilantro and lime zest. Serve hot over rice.
